The Baul Dimension Experience Part 3

bibi-russel at Jungle Line studio

i’ve also encountered a great Lady: Bibi Russel. She is an international former top model of the seventies who has created  “Fashion for Development”, a project promoting the techniques of Bangladeshi craftsmen. Bibi is also Embassador of the Unesco. The first time I met her I’ve been so impressed by her beauty and her [...]

The Baul Dimension Experience Part 1

jck-baul-dim3500x500

I visited Dhaka in Bangladesh twice . The French foreign Ministry has helped me to setup my trip. Mr Raynouart and Mr Steyer, cultural advisors for the French Embassy of Dhaka, gave me a great support as well.

As soon as i landed the first time in Dhaka, I was chocked by the poverty, [...]
